Massive Livermore Bust Seizes Fireworks, Drugs, Cash

Police said they found multiple drugs, hundreds of vape products and more than 200 pounds of illegal fireworks in a Livermore home.

LIVERMORE, CA — Livermore police say they found a large cache of drugs, illegal fireworks and vape products, and thousands of dollars in cash at a Livermore residence Wednesday.

On Wednesday night, the LPD's Crime Prevention Unit served a narcotics-related search warrant at a residence on North I Street. During the search, officers say they located:

  • Nearly 3 ounces of cocaine
  • Nearly 2 ounces of psilocybin
  • Approximately 0.5 ounces of methamphethamine
  • Approximately 1.5 pounds of cannabis
  • More than 100 flavored vapes
  • More than 100 cannabis apes and edibles
  • More than 200 pounds of illegal fireworks
  • More than $3,000 in cash

Juan Carlos Cruz, 19, was arrested on multiple charges, including possession and sales of narcotics and possession of more than 100 pounds of illegal fireworks, police said.
